Description

The EAYE Annual Meeting is a leading general-interest economics conference that brings together junior researchers from across the globe. It covers a broad range of topics in economics, providing a central forum for presenting frontier research and fostering exchange among emerging scholars.

Each year, the conference receives over 600 submissions and selects approximately 130 papers through a rigorous peer-review process. The scientific program spans three days and includes ten sessions, with five parallel sessions running at each time slot. This format ensures high attendance in sessions while offering ample opportunities for discussion and networking across fields.

Participants are primarily assistant professors and advanced PhD students, each accounting for roughly 45% of attendees, with most doctoral participants nearing completion of their PhD. The meeting also attracts postdoctoral researchers and economists from central banks and other research institutions. In 2025, participants were affiliated with more than 100 institutions worldwide, including leading European and North American universities as well as major central banks.

The program includes two keynote lectures delivered by internationally renowned economists. Complementing the academic program, the conference features two major social events—a reception and a conference dinner—designed as prime networking occasions and an integral part of the Annual Meeting experience.
